Frequently Asked Questions About the Dunedin to Middlemarch Rail Journey
1. What can I expect from a 3-day rail package between Dunedin and Middlemarch?
The 3-day rail package from Dunedin to Middlemarch offers travelers a comprehensive experience of the Otago region's natural and cultural wealth. The journey typically includes:
- Day 1: Departure from Dunedin - Depart the historic Dunedin Railway Station, an architectural marvel, as you start your journey through the rolling hills and farmlands towards Middlemarch.
- Day 2: Exploring Middlemarch - This small town offers hiking and cycling trails, including access to the iconic Otago Central Rail Trail, perfect for outdoor enthusiasts.
- Day 3: Return Journey - On your way back to Dunedin, enjoy sweeping vistas of the Taieri Gorge and rural landscapes, offering a different perspective and plenty of photo opportunities.

3. How does the scenery differ between Dunedin and Middlemarch?
The transition from Dunedin to Middlemarch provides a fascinating shift in scenery. Dunedin is known for its Victorian and Edwardian architecture and beautiful coastal vistas, whereas Middlemarch is your gateway to expansive rural landscapes and pastoral settings.
Notable scenic highlights include:
- Deep river gorges, such as the Taieri Gorge, which you can view from the comfort of the train as it winds along the cliff sides.
- High country landscapes and open plains as you reach Middlemarch, offering stark, breathtaking views that contrast with coastal Dunedin.
The vistas are constantly changing; each season offers a new image canvas, from the snowy peaks in winter to the vibrant yellows and greens of spring and summer.

1. What activities can I engage in during the layover in Middlemarch?
Middlemarch may be small, but it's packed with activities that can enrich your travel experience:
- Otago Central Rail Trail: Rent a bike or walk parts of this famous rail-to-trail pathway.
- Local Hikes: Tackle nearby trails that cater to various fitness levels, allowing you to immerse yourself in nature's tranquility.
- Community Events: Depending on the time of year, attend local farmers' markets or festivals celebrating the region's heritage.
